Transaction 2f5c25509a64a793f62a1aa023d65bf5a94ca0ed3e803cf105405938d852a86a

1 Input
2 Outputs
  • 2f5c25509a64a793f62a1aa023d65bf5a94ca0ed3e803cf105405938d852a86a:0
  • value  310856
    address  38AHNBXrUQk2tsBwjMwy3iBHAAGjPjuJUy
  • 2f5c25509a64a793f62a1aa023d65bf5a94ca0ed3e803cf105405938d852a86a:1
  • value  23824
    address  bc1q0u8uzfqjxrcdkwjgfatgpfmhwudwyj6s4w5xkk